摘 要:父母教育卷入对儿童青少年学业成绩和心理发展的重要影响,越来越受到各国政府和研究者的重视,同时,愈来愈多的研究者和机构将提升父母的教育卷入作为教育干预的重要手段,以促进受干预儿童的学业成功和心理发展。识别出可能影响父母教育卷入的因素是有效增强父母教育卷入行为的关键性环节。本研究探索了中国文化背景下男孩和女孩父母教育卷入的相关预测性因素,结果表明,父母受教育水平显著预测男孩和女孩父母的教育卷入水平,女孩父母的工作时间显著负向预测其教育卷入水平。在考虑了独生情况和家庭社会经济地位之后,父母心理因素中的父母角色活跃信念、学校效价、感知到的知识技能和感知到的时间精力仍然能够显著预测男孩父母和女孩父母的教育卷入水平。本研究表明,相比家庭社会经济地位,心理因素是父母教育卷入更为重要的预测源。Previous literature has revealed that parental involvement have significant effects on children's academic achievement and social development. The important role of parental involvement in children's learning has been recognized by academics, educators, parents, and policy makers. In fact, increasing numbers of researchers and research institutes have targeted parental involvement as the major means and protective factor to promote academic achievement of children at risk. Identifying the predictors of parental involvement is the key to better understand the determinants of parental involvement and thus researchers can effectively foster it through parenting intervention programs. The present study has explored the predicting effects of family social economic status and parents' psychological factors on parental involvement within Chinese population and the differential relationships in families with daughters and families with sons. The results demonstrated that parents' educational level could significantly predicted parental involvement within girl families and boy families, while working hours could only negatively predicted parental involvement of girls but not boys. After considering sibling status and family SES, parents' psychological factors could still predict parental involvement, no matter in girl families or boy families. These results suggest that, compared to family SES, parents' psychological factors are more important in predicting parental involvement.
